Service Provider Experience and Credentials



Before hiring a roofing contractor, it's critical to thoroughly analyze their experience and qualifications. Start by asking how long they've been in the roof organization. A contractor with years of experience is most likely to supply top quality work.

Ask about the types of roof covering jobs they've worked with in the past. Recognizing their expertise in certain roof covering materials or styles can aid you assess if they're the ideal fit for your task.

Examining a professional's qualifications is crucial. Ask if they're licensed and guaranteed. A licensed specialist has actually satisfied the needed requirements and is more probable to adhere to building regulations and regulations. Insurance secures you from obligation in case of mishaps at work.

Demand references and follow up with past customers to obtain a sense of the professional's dependability and function quality.

Task Information And Facts and Timeline



Think about laying out the specifics of your roof covering job and establishing a timeline with the professional. Start by plainly specifying the scope of job. This need to consist of information such as the materials to be utilized, any type of needed repairs, and the anticipated conclusion day. Connecting your assumptions upfront can assist make sure that both you and the specialist get on the very same page throughout the project.

When reviewing the timeline with the professional, be sure to inquire about the approximated start day and projected period of the project. Comprehending the length of time the work will certainly take can aid you plan appropriately and lessen any kind of disruptions to your day-to-day routine.


Additionally, ask about any aspects that might potentially create hold-ups, such as weather or material availability.
